Discussion & Documentation: 

Johann Daniel Hämelmann married Anna Elisabeth Grun. They have at least 1 daughter: Anna Margaretha, born in Wehrda on 26 June 1732. She married in 1754 to Johann Valentin Melcher and immigrated to Russia. [See Melcher Family.]

Daniel Hämelmann re-married to Elisabeth Sippel. They have at least 1 daughter: Anna Margaretha “Eva” Hämelmann, born in Wehrda on 31 December 1740. She married in 1761 to Johannes Wagner and immigrated to Russia. [See Wagner Family.]

There are no known surviving male lines of the Hämelmann family among the Volga German colonies.
